    FITUR 2026 Set to Ignite New Business Opportunities Between the U.S. and Spain Tourism Sectors

    FITUR 2026 to boost business opportunities between the tourism sectors of the United States and Spain – Morningstar
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link Tumblr Reddit VKontakte Telegram WhatsApp

    FITUR 2026 is set to play a pivotal role in advancing business opportunities between the tourism sectors of the United States and Spain, according to industry experts and stakeholders gathered at the annual event. As one of the world’s leading tourism fairs, FITUR provides a dynamic platform for collaboration, innovation, and strategic partnerships. This year’s edition, highlighted by Morningstar’s analysis, underscores the growing economic ties and mutual benefits that both countries stand to gain from increased cooperation in travel, hospitality, and related services. The event promises to attract key players eager to explore new markets and strengthen existing connections in an increasingly competitive global tourism landscape.

    Key Market Trends Driving Growth in Transatlantic Travel

    As global travel steadily rebounds, transatlantic journeys between the United States and Spain are witnessing a dynamic surge fueled by evolving traveler preferences and enhanced connectivity. Increasing demand for experiential tourism, where visitors seek authentic cultural and culinary experiences, is reshaping itineraries and boosting niche markets such as wine tourism in Spain’s Rioja region and historic city tours in the U.S. East Coast. Meanwhile, low-cost carriers and expanded flight routes are making these destinations more accessible, breaking down traditional barriers and encouraging spontaneous travel.

    Several market forces are converging to propel this growth:

    • Technological innovation: Smart travel apps and AI-driven personalized recommendations are improving trip planning and in-destination experiences.
    • Sustainability focus: Travelers increasingly prefer eco-friendly accommodations and tours, pushing businesses to adopt greener practices.
    • Business travel revival: An uptick in conferences and trade shows between both countries is renewing corporate travel demand.
